This skill provides patterns for unit testing @ConfigurationProperties bindings, environment-specific configurations, and property validation using JUnit 5. Covers testing property name mapping, type conversions, validation constraints, nested structures, and profile-specific configurations without full Spring context startup.

class SecurityPropertiesTest {
@Test
void shouldBindPropertiesFromEnvironment() {
new ApplicationContextRunner()
.withPropertyValues(
"app.security.jwtSecret=my-secret-key",
"app.security.jwtExpirationMs=3600000",
"app.security.maxLoginAttempts=5",
"app.security.enableTwoFactor=true"
)
.withBean(SecurityProperties.class)
.run(context -> {
SecurityProperties props = context.getBean(SecurityProperties.class);
assertThat(props.getJwtSecret()).isEqualTo("my-secret-key");
assertThat(props.getJwtExpirationMs()).isEqualTo(3600000L);
assertThat(props.getMaxLoginAttempts()).isEqualTo(5);
assertThat(props.isEnableTwoFactor()).isTrue();
});
}
@Test
void shouldUseDefaultValuesWhenPropertiesNotProvided() {
new ApplicationContextRunner()
.withPropertyValues("app.security.jwtSecret=key")
.withBean(SecurityProperties.class)
.run(context -> {
SecurityProperties props = context.getBean(SecurityProperties.class);
assertThat(props.getJwtSecret()).isEqualTo("key");
assertThat(props.getMaxLoginAttempts()).isZero();
});
}

class ConfigurationValidationTest {
@Test
void shouldFailValidationWhenHostIsBlank() {
new ApplicationContextRunner()
.withPropertyValues(
"app.server.host=",
"app.server.port=8080",
"app.server.threadPoolSize=10"
)
.withBean(ServerProperties.class)
.run(context -> {
assertThat(context).hasFailed()
.getFailure()
.hasMessageContaining("host");
});
}
@Test
void shouldPassValidationWithValidConfiguration() {
new ApplicationContextRunner()
.withPropertyValues(
"app.server.host=localhost",
"app.server.port=8080",
"app.server.threadPoolSize=10"
)
.withBean(ServerProperties.class)
.run(context -> {
assertThat(context).hasNotFailed();
assertThat(context.getBean(ServerProperties.class).getHost()).isEqualTo("localhost");
});
}

class TypeConversionTest {
@Test
void shouldConvertDurationFromString() {
new ApplicationContextRunner()
.withPropertyValues("app.features.cacheExpiry=30s")
.withBean(FeatureProperties.class)
.run(context -> {
assertThat(context.getBean(FeatureProperties.class).getCacheExpiry())
.isEqualTo(Duration.ofSeconds(30));
});
}
@Test
void shouldConvertCommaDelimitedList() {
new ApplicationContextRunner()
.withPropertyValues("app.features.enabledFeatures=feature1,feature2")
.withBean(FeatureProperties.class)
.run(context -> {
assertThat(context.getBean(FeatureProperties.class).getEnabledFeatures())
.containsExactly("feature1", "feature2");
});
}

|---|---|---|
| Properties not binding | Prefix mismatch | Verify @ConfigurationProperties(prefix="...") matches property paths |
| Validation not triggered | Missing @Validated | Add @Validated annotation to configuration class |
| Context fails to start | Missing dependencies | Ensure spring-boot-starter-test is in test scope |
| Nested properties null | Inner class missing | Use @Data on nested classes or provide getters/setters |
| Collection binding fails | Wrong indexing | Use [0], [1] notation, not (0), (1) |
